GSA Tool Kit Requirement to Drop from 100% to 51% USA-Made?
Harry Epstein’s Daily Dispatch broke the news that the US government’s GSA is changing the requirement for tool kits to be 100% USA-made. According to their source, such kits must only be 51% USA-made from now on.Continue Reading

A Bunch of Craftsman & Other Older Compressors Recalled
About 460,000 compressors that were manufactured from 2000 until 2005 are being recalled. This includes several 15 gal Craftsman compressors and a few Porter Cable (4 & 6 gal), Delta Shopmaster (12 gal), DeVilbiss (3 gal) and Husky compressors (25 gal).Continue Reading

Sale of Delta Woodworking Power Tool Co. is Confirmed
We received official word that Stanley Black & Decker will finalize the sale of Delta Woodworking Machinery to Chang Type Industries in early February. The new independent company will be called Delta Power Equipment Corporation, and will be based in Anderson County …Continue Reading
